Rottnest Island, or “Rotto” as the locals call it, is a small island paradise that is home to some of the most beautiful beaches in Australia. With over 63 beaches and 20 bays to explore, there is no shortage of stunning spots to relax and soak up the sun. The island is also home to a unique and friendly marsupial, the quokka, which has become a popular attraction for visitors. These small, furry creatures are known for their adorable smiles and are often seen hopping around the island.

Rottnest Island Beaches

Rottnest Island | Beaches

With so many beaches to choose from, it can be hard to decide where to start. But some of the must-visit beaches on Rottnest Island include The Basin, Little Salmon Bay, and Pinky Beach. The Basin is a popular spot for snorkeling and swimming, with its calm and clear waters. Little Salmon Bay is a great spot for families, with its shallow waters and picnic areas. And Pinky Beach is perfect for those looking for a more secluded and romantic beach experience.
